I guess it all depends on what kind of relationship you have with the man in question and what problems you're having with his hair. IF he's not a lover, yet, then your suggestions to groom differently may or may not be received very well.

IF a lover's body hair turns you off or bothers you, then you can express that in as delicate a way as possible. HOWEVER, that doesn't mean that he will agree to do anything about it or be willing to "groom" himself any differently. Remember, this is an ongoing process and it takes time to shave body hair. There's also some discomfort involved.

AND, when expressing your feelings about this subject, be prepared that turnabout is fair play and he may likely have some suggestions for YOU, as well.

The only time it would truly be too much, though, would be if it's causing irritation or difficulty doing what you want for each other.

Everyone has their preferences about this subject, of course, but if I cared deeply for the man, then I would accept him as is and then, deal with any resulting problems as they came up.
